Job Responsibilities
Specific to role:
- Support complex analysis for Publication
- Reviewing abstract, posters, manuscripts
- Strong communication, challenge the medical, make good proposal, collaborate
- Basic programming in SAS and/or R required
- Observational studies (propensity score, causal inference, etc. ) experience beneficial
- Experience in RWE is acceptable
- Study and project planning beneficial
- Experience in clinical trials would be good to have
- Experience in HTA/HEOR – present for additional position if such candidates are identified
General
- Serves as a statistical department resource, mentors biostatisticians on job skills, and oversees or develops training plans or materials for Biostatistics associates.
- Directs the activities of other biostatistics personnel on assigned projects to ensure timely completion of high quality work.
- Provides independent review of project work produced by other biostatisticians in the department.
- Provides support across all statistical tasks during the lifecycle of the project, from protocol to CSR.
- Prepares or oversees the preparation of Statistical Analysis Plans (SAPs).
- Creates or reviews programming specifications for analysis datasets, tables, listings, and figures.
- Reviews SAS annotated case report forms (CRFs), database design, and other study documentation.
- Implements company objectives, and creates alternative solutions to address business and operational challenges.
- As biostatistics representative on project teams, interfaces with other departmental project team representatives.
- Conducts and participates in verification and quality control of project deliverables.
- May lead complex or multiple projects and attend regulatory agency meetings.
- Monitors progress on study activities against agreed upon milestones.
- Provides statistical programming support as needed.
- May participate in Data Safety Monitoring Board (DSMB) and/or Data Monitoring Committee (DMC) activities.

Qualifications
What we’re looking for
- Graduate degree in biostatistics or related discipline.
- Extensive experience in clinical trials or an equivalent combination of education and experience.
- Proficiency in programming.
- Ability to apply extensive knowledge of statistical design, analysis, relevant regulatory guidelines, and programming techniques.
- Experience across all statistical tasks required to support clinical trials.
- Experience with regulatory submissions preferred.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
- Ability to read, write, speak, and understand English.
